CVE-2018-13374 describes an improper access control in Fortinet FortiOS (versions including 6.0.2, 5.6.7 and earlier) and FortiADC (6.1.0, 6.0.0–6.0.1, 5.4.0–5.4.4). An LDAP-credentials disclosure occurs when a LDAP connectivity test is pointed to a rogue LDAP server instead of the configured one...

Denial Of Service (DoS)
389-ds-base is vulnerable to denial of service. An invalid pointer dereference flaw was found in the way 389-ds-base handled LDAP bind requests. A remote unauthenticated attacker could use this flaw to make ns-slapd crash via a specially crafted LDAP bind request, resulting in denial of service...
